Customer Satisfaction with Nottingham City Transport has reached record levels in its latest annual customer survey, as five times UK Bus Operator of the Year achieves an overall satisfaction score of 96%.

The survey was conducted on all NCT bus routes and online, and the results based on over 5,000 responses. Customers are asked several questions to rate how satisfied they are with specific features of their service, along with questions about the travel habits.

The high satisfaction scores reflect NCT’s proactive response to the well documented national shortage of bus drivers. This included increasing pay rates by up to 25% in the last 18 months, which has seen 153 new drivers join NCT in the last year, as well as advertising realistic timetables that can be consistently delivered.

This has resulted in improved performance for customers, with 99% of all scheduled journeys operating during the last 12 months and currently 94% of journeys operating on time.

Nottingham’s bus network continues to recover post-pandemic. Overall usage of the NCT network is at around 90% of pre-COVID demand, with bus-use per head of population in Nottingham the second highest in the country, outside London.

NCT’s network continues to provide a sustainable, convenient alternative to the car, with 26.5% of respondents choosing to use the bus over a car they had available for the journey they were making. On some routes, this is as high as 43%, with customers using NCT for work, shopping, socialising, medical appointments and getting to school, college, university.
